General Hideki Tojo was the man who led Japan into World War 2 and oversaw some of the most horrific war crimes in recorded history. Tojo did not hold absolute power - his means of imposing his will were more nuanced than that. But he more than earns his place at this table. Ruling under a compliant Emperor, Tojo gathered power to himself. This is the story of the minister who outgrew his master, the bureaucrat whose relentless work ethic took him to the apex of Japan’s totalitarian military state. Hideki Tojo is born in 1884. Japan is an emerging power on the world stage, a nation growing in confidence and ambition. We chart Tojo’s upbringing through the 1880s and ‘90s, before the man they call “The Razor” begins his journey up the greasy pole of Japanese politics. Learn more about your ad choices.
